What companies run services between Lenzerheide, Switzerland and Basel, Switzerland?

There is no direct connection from Lenzerheide to Basel. However, you can take the line 182 bus to Chur, Postautostation, walk to Chur, then take the train to Basel SBB.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Lenzerheide/Lai, Post to Basel, Bahnhof via Chur, Postautostation, Chur, Zürich HB, and Zürich Bus Station in around 4h 5m.
